Shihan Jonas Nuñez Jr.
Shihan Jonas Nuñez Jr. is the Director and founder of the America's Finest Karate and Kickboxing Academy with locations throughout the New York, New Jersey and Connecticut tri-state area.
The following is a brief history of Jonas' martial arts background:

Jonas was born in Manhattan in 1960 to Jonas Nuñez Sr. and Lita Feliciano Nuñez. His parents moved from Manhattan to the Bronx and thus at age four he began his martial arts training.

Jonas started his training under Sifu BOB MAHONEY in the style of Shaolin Kempo Kung Fu. At the age of nine years old he become an assistant instructor for the children's class until Sifu MAHONEY made a pilgrimage to China and decided to remain there.

Young Jonas' efforts to continue his martial arts training led him to Sensei Elliot Soto a 4th Degree Black belt in the Urban Goju-Ryu System. After numerous years with Sensei Soto, Jonas Nuñez Jr. received his 3rd Degree Black Belt. At the same time when not practicing Goju-Ryu Karate, Jonas started studying Mudukwan Korean Karate with Sabomnim Frank Santiago (a DEA Officer in the Bronx) and David Gonzalez his best student. Eventually this additional training earned him a 2nd Degree Black Belt in Korean Karate.

During his training, Jonas began competing in local and national tournaments in Karate and Kickboxing. While competing in the Ying Yee Karate/Kung Fu Championship (promoted by Kyoshi Archie Rullen), he met another competitor Tommy Chen. Mr. Chen was currently the East Coast top Forms and Weapons champion and a top rated semi-contact and full contact fighter. Mr. Chen invited Jonas to his Dojo in Brooklyn under the direction of Dennis Chen (Tommy's father), where they taught an Okinawan system of karate called Shindo-Ryu Karate-Do. Jonas decided that Master Chen was a complete and well-rounded martial artist and thus began his training in Shindo-Ryu in 1978. Two years later (in 1980), Jonas received his 2nd degree Black belt under Master Chen and opened his first school in the Northern Bronx.

Promotion to 8th Degree Black Belt

In 2001 at the Oriental World Self Defense and Kickboxing Championships (held at Madison Square Garden), Grand Master Aaron Banks and Kyoshi Tommy Chen promoted Jonas to 8th Degree Black Belt for his continuing efforts in promoting and competing in martial arts.

Jonas continues to promote and compete in all aspects of the martial arts and has
produced 7 World Kickboxing Champions.
Some of his students now operate successful schools in Connecticut, Florida and California.

Professional Kickboxing Federation (PKF).
The Professional Kickboxing Federation (PKF) is an East Coast presentation established by Shihan Jonas Nuñez Jr., an 8th Degree Black Belt and Head instructor of America’s Finest Karate and Kickboxing Academy. With a total of thirty (30) divisions, which includes women, the PKF has structured opportunities for amateurs and professionals to compete in the sport of kickboxing on a regular basis.
